Latest Patents
Hochan Chang holds a patent for the "Synthesis of functional polyurethanes and polyesters from biomass-derived monomers." This patent describes a method of making polyesters and polyurethanes from biomass-derived polyols. The polyol used in this process is derived from biomass and features a specific structure where dashed bonds represent single or double bonds, and R is selected from the group consisting of —OH and —O. The process involves reacting the polyol with a diisocyanate to produce polyurethanes and with a dicarboxylic acid to create polyesters. He has 1 patent to his name.
